England legend Alec Stewart, in a very surprising statement, said that a Surrey wicketkeeper who’s never played international cricket is the world’s best wicketkeeper.  Ben Foakes, a 24-year-old who has played two seasons at the London-club in which the England legend is a director of cricket, was bestowed the honour by the 133-Test veteran on Wednesday.

It is, however, very rare to call a domestic wicketkeeper as the world’s best, when you have names like MS Dhoni and the like. But Stewart doesn’t want to be biased towards the big names.

“I’ve got to be careful not to be biased when it comes to Foakesy, because I reckon he’s the best wicketkeeper in the world,” Stewart, who sits third on England’s all-time Test run-scoring and dismissals lists, told ESPN.

“When he’s batting, he’s Test-match quality, but he’s got a very good cricketer ahead of him in Jonny Bairstow.

Ever since leaving Essex, Foakes has forged a reputation as one the best glovemen in the domestic circuit. He executed 46 dismissals for Surrey in 15 matches last season – the second-highest tally in Division One – and also racked up 759 runs at 42.16.

While he hasn’t yet made his international debut, the youngster has featured in 19 games for the England Lions in all 3 formats and was very instrumental on their recent tour of Sri Lanka.

“When I say he’s the best in the world, I mean I haven’t seen any better. I’m not saying he’s in Jack’s class or Alan Knott’s class, or Ian Healy’s class. But of those currently playing, of what I’ve seen, I haven’t seen anyone better.” he maintained.

If at all Foakes makes it to international cricket some day, we may get to witness his sparkling dismissals behind the wickets and know if he can translate his domestic feats to international ones.
